We are searching for a Project Manager/Sr. Consultant in the Paper/Packaging industry at our FORT WASHINGTON, Pennsylvania office. This role revolves around leading and successfully completing customer projects, assisting in the development of presentations and proposals, driving internal efficiency improvements, and mentoring other team members.

Responsibilities:

  • Lead the creation and ongoing management of project plans, ensuring proactive communication with team members regarding upcoming activities and milestones.
  • Execute project activities in accordance with implementation methodology.
  • Lead and facilitate project meetings effectively.
  • Manage the project issue log and drive each issue to completion including follow-up with designated owner, establishment of plan to resolve, and confirming with key project personnel that resolution is acceptable.
  • Conduct status reporting and client invoicing.
  • Lead and/or assist in the development of presentations and proposals for customers and/or internal stakeholders.
  • Drive improvements across the organization with the objective of increasing efficiencies internally and improving our ability to service our customers.
  • Support organizational initiatives including sales cycle support, practice aid development, and improving operating procedures.
  • Maintain an extensive understanding of the capabilities and functionality of our solutions and familiarity with the industries our solutions support.
  • Mentor and support other team members to improve their skillsets and ability to successfully implement our solutions.
